When It’s Time to Get Your A/c Repaired

Is the level of comfort in your house disappointing what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le issues that, if ignored, could cause more severe repair work or the need for an early replacement of your air conditioner. While a unit that will not turn on is a clear indication that you need repair work, there are other, less apparent problems. If you are familiar with the more subtle indications of a issue with your air conditioning, you will have the ability to call a professional service professional quicker rather than later on.

If any of the following use, among our Kansas AC repair experts advises that you give us a call:

  • You are incurring an increase in the quantity of cash needed to pay for your month-to-month energy costs: Inefficient operation of your a/c can be brought on by a variety of different concerns, including leaking ductwork, an internal breakdown, or a defective thermostat. This means that it has to work harder to keep your property cool, which will lead to a considerable boost in the quantity that you pay in energy bills.
  • You just see h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, make sure you haven’t inadvertently set the thermostat to the inaccurate temperature level by checking it. If that is not the case, then you probably have a issue on the inside of your air conditioning unit, and you need to get it inspected by a professional.
  • You are seeing a higher humidity level at your property: Even though this is not the main function of your air conditioner, it is responsible for managing the humidity level inside of your home or business structure. Higher humidity suggests that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can result in the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is important that you get this matter solved as rapidly as humanly feasible, especially for the sake of your security.
  • The airflow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ide array of aspects that can lead to insufficient air flow. We will require to perform a comprehensive evaluation in order to find out whether the issue is the outcome of a stopped up air filter, an problem with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, leaking ductwork, or obstructed duct.
  • You observe that there is a substantial amount of wetness in the location around your unit: Condensation is a natural event, however it should not exist in excessive quantities. It is possible that you have a leaking refrigerant or a clogged up drain tube if you discover any excess moisture or pooling water in the location.
  • Weird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an a/c to produce some background sound while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ible shrieking,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an obvious indicator that something requires to be fixed.
  • It appears that there is a problem with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the issues you’re having with your a/c unit. If you have hot and cold areas around your home, your unit won’t shut off, or it will not begin,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your unit won’t begin, it could also be due to the fact that it will not shut down.
  • Foul odors are originating from your system: There might be a problem with your air conditioner if you smell anything burning or a moldy smell. These smells can be triggered by a range of factors, consisting of mold advancement and charred wiring.
  • Your unit turns often between the following states: When the temperature inside your home reaches the level that you have chosen on the thermostat, air conditioners are programmed to switch off immediately. Despite this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ises

There are a couple of sounds that should not be heard originating from ac system although they do not operate in full silence. These noises might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king noise. These particular sounds generally suggest that there is a problem within the a/c unit that needs to be repaired by a specialist of in Leavenworth County.

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your AC The following must be consisted of:

  • Banging: The problem is generally the compressor in an a/c that is making a banging sound. This part of the air conditioning system is accountable for delivering refrigerant to the numerous other elements of the system in order to get rid of excess heat from your home. Compressor parts might relax as the AC system ages. This noise is brought on by the parts moving around and rattling and crashing one another.
  • Shrieking: A broken blower fan motor within the a/c might produce a sound similar to shrieking or screeching if the motor is working improperly. Typically, a faulty f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Shut off the AC immediately and contact a professional for repairs whenever you hear a screeching sound.
  •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never ever a excellent indication to hear originating from any sort of mechanical object. Pistons inside the compressor might have worn out, which may result in this grinding noise emanating from the a/c.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it generally shows that the compressor itself needs to be changed. The total air conditioning unit could require to be changed depending upon the design of air conditioner and how old it is.
  • Clicking: It is really common for an a/c unit to make a clicking noise when it initially switches on. If you hear clicking throughout the entire du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the result of a thermostat that is not working properly.
